VPS没有安全组怎么办?如何手动配置安全组规则?
| 问题类型 |
原因分析 |
解决方案 |
| 无法创建安全组 |
云服务商限制或账户权限不足 |
检查账户权限或联系服务商开通功能 |
| 规则配置错误 |
端口/协议设置不当 |
参考模板规则或服务商文档 |
| 规则不生效 |
未绑定到实例 |
在控制台完成安全组与实例的关联 |
VPS没有安全组的解决方案
当您的VPS没有安全组时,可以通过以下步骤手动配置安全组规则来保障服务器安全:
一、安全组基础配置步骤
- 登录云控制台
- 访问您使用的云服务商控制台(如腾讯云、阿里云等)
- 使用账户凭证登录后进入VPS管理界面
- 创建安全组
- 在"网络与安全"或类似菜单中找到安全组选项
- 点击"创建安全组"按钮,选择适合的模板:
- 放通22(SSH)、80(HTTP)、443(HTTPS)等常用端口
- 或选择自定义配置
- 配置入站规则
# 示例:放行SSH端口的规则配置
协议类型:TCP
端口范围:22
源IP:0.0.0.0/0(生产环境建议限制特定IP)
优先级:1
二、替代方案(无安全组功能时)
如果您的VPS服务商不支持安全组功能,可以通过以下方式增强安全性:
- 配置系统防火墙
sudo ufw allow 22/tcp # 放行SSH
sudo ufw enable # 启用防火墙
- 修改默认服务端口
- 更改SSH默认端口(22)为非常用端口
- 编辑/etc/ssh/sshd_config文件:
Port 2222
三、常见问题解答
| 问题现象 |
可能原因 |
解决方法 |
| 无法远程连接 |
防火墙阻止端口 |
检查系统防火墙规则 |
| 服务访问异常 |
安全组规则冲突 |
按优先级检查规则顺序 |
| 规则修改不生效 |
未保存/未关联 |
确认保存并绑定到实例 |
四、安全建议
- 定期审查安全组规则,删除不必要的开放端口
- 使用密钥认证替代密码登录SSH
- 对重要服务设置IP白名单限制
- 监控异常登录尝试,及时更新系统补丁
通过以上步骤,即使VPS没有安全组功能,您也能有效提升服务器的安全性。建议优先选择支持安全组功能的云服务商,以获得更便捷的安全管理体验。
发表评论